
TPU (rubber-like)
Combining the properties of plastic and rubber, TPU produces elastic, highly durable parts that can bend and compress. TPU is resistant to oils, greases, and a variety of solvents.
Technology:
Shore Hardness: 85A
This rubber-like thermoplastic is incredibly functional. Use TPU for prototypes or end-use parts.

Advantages

flexible
Works best for parts that need to bend and snap back.

stress resistant
Can withstand lots of strength, pressure, and isn't prone to tearing.

rubber-like
TPU fills the gap between rubbers and plastics.
